Weeping figs like warm temperatures, to 70 degrees F. at night and 85 (21 and 29 C.) during the day. For the best ficus plant care, provide high humidity, with 40% relative humidity set as the minimum for undisturbed growth. Note that the more light and the warmer the temperature, the more humidity and water the tree requires.

The Ficus "too little" is a cultivar of the Ficus Benjamin, specially selected for its desirable characteristics. It is a species of fig tree, native to South and Southeast Asia and Australia. The thick shiny evergreen leaves generously cloth the long branches.

Too Little is a dwarf version of Ficus benjamina that makes an excellent houseplant. It's really easy to grow as a bonsai with its small, curled, and dense growth habit.•. Average mature height: 1-2 feet• Watering: Keep moist but not soggy• Fertilizing: Houseplant formula once a month• Light: Part sun• Zone: 10 Plant Si.

Too little light - Another reason for ficus tree leaves falling off is that the tree is getting too little light. Often, a ficus tree that is getting too little light will look sparse and spindly. New leaves may also appear pale or even white. In this case, you should move the ficus tree to a location where it will get more light. Pests - Ficus.

The Ficus 'TooLittle' is a cultivar of Ficus benjamina with tiny recurved glossy leaves on twiggy branches, used mainly for indoor bonsai due to its miniature size. ~Although drought tolerant, do not allow your Ficus to dry out too much. In general, Ficus should be kept slightly moist during the growing season. Water when the top 2" of soil are.
